    During the 𝟮𝟬𝟮𝟱 𝑮𝒆𝒏𝒆𝒓𝒂𝒍 𝑴𝒆𝒆𝒕𝒊𝒏𝒈 𝒐𝒇 𝒕𝒉𝒆 横浜国立大学/ Yokohama National University(YNU)𝑪𝒊𝒗𝒊𝒍 𝑬𝒏𝒈𝒊𝒏𝒆𝒆𝒓𝒊𝒏𝒈 𝑨𝒍𝒖𝒎𝒏𝒊 𝑨𝒔𝒔𝒐𝒄𝒊𝒂𝒕𝒊𝒐𝒏, held on July 6, Mr. Hiroyuki Takashina received an award for his master's thesis titled “𝙎𝙩𝙧𝙪𝙘𝙩𝙪𝙧𝙖𝙡 𝙁𝙖𝙩𝙞𝙜𝙪𝙚 𝙀𝙨𝙩𝙞𝙢𝙖𝙩𝙞𝙤𝙣 𝙤𝙛 𝙀𝙢𝙗𝙚𝙙𝙙𝙚𝙙 𝘾𝙤𝙣𝙣𝙚𝙘𝙩𝙞𝙤𝙣 𝙤𝙛 𝘾𝙤𝙣𝙘𝙧𝙚𝙩𝙚 𝙁𝙡𝙤𝙖𝙩𝙞𝙣𝙜 𝙎𝙪𝙗𝙨𝙩𝙧𝙪𝙘𝙩𝙪𝙧𝙚 𝙛𝙤𝙧 15𝙈𝙒 𝙒𝙞𝙣𝙙 𝙏𝙪𝙧𝙗𝙞𝙣𝙚.”

    Additionally, Mr. 𝐊𝐞𝐧𝐬𝐡𝐢𝐧 𝐌𝐚𝐫𝐮𝐲𝐚𝐦𝐚 was recognized for his graduation thesis, “𝙎𝙩𝙪𝙙𝙮 𝙤𝙣 𝙩𝙝𝙚 𝙄𝙢𝙥𝙧𝙤𝙫𝙚𝙢𝙚𝙣𝙩 𝙤𝙛 𝙋𝙧𝙤𝙥𝙚𝙧𝙩𝙞𝙚𝙨 𝙤𝙛 𝙂𝙧𝙖𝙣𝙪𝙡𝙖𝙩𝙚𝙙 𝙋𝙤𝙧𝙤𝙪𝙨 𝘾𝙤𝙣𝙘𝙧𝙚𝙩𝙚 𝙗𝙮 𝙐𝙩𝙞𝙡𝙞𝙯𝙞𝙣𝙜 𝙎𝙡𝙪𝙙𝙜𝙚 𝙒𝙖𝙩𝙚𝙧.” Both theses were acknowledged with certificates and commemorative gifts as part of the 𝐁𝐞𝐬𝐭 𝐑𝐞𝐬𝐞𝐚𝐫𝐜𝐡 𝐀𝐰𝐚𝐫𝐝.
